What is Pfizer Other Long-Term Liabilities?

Pfizer XSWX:PFE -0.79% 72 Other Long-Term Liabilities is CHF11,750 Mil as of Mar. 2026. GuruFocus rates XSWX:PFE with a GF Score™ of 72/100 and a GF Value™ of CHF21.24 (Fairly Valued). The stock has 5 warning signs investors should review.

Pfizer's other long-term liabilities for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 was CHF11,750 Mil.

Pfizer's quarterly other long-term liabilities increased from Sep. 2025 (CHF11,519 Mil) to Dec. 2025 (CHF12,401 Mil) but then declined from Dec. 2025 (CHF12,401 Mil) to Mar. 2026 (CHF11,750 Mil).

Pfizer's annual other long-term liabilities declined from Dec. 2023 (CHF15,202 Mil) to Dec. 2024 (CHF13,242 Mil) and declined from Dec. 2024 (CHF13,242 Mil) to Dec. 2025 (CHF12,401 Mil).

Pfizer Other Long-Term Liabilities Calculation

Other Long-Term Liabilities are the other liabilities on the balance sheet that do not need to be repaid within the next 12 months, but still need to be repaid over time. For instance, on Wal-Mart's balance sheet, there are items called Long Term obligations under capital leases, deferred income taxes, and redeemable non-controlling interest. These are all Other Long-Term Liabilities.

Pfizer Business Description

Address 66 Hudson Boulevard East, New York, NY, USA, 10001-2192
Pfizer is one of the world's largest pharmaceutical firms, with annual sales of roughly $60 billion. While it historically sold many types of healthcare products and chemicals, now prescription drugs and vaccines account for the majority of sales. Top sellers include pneumococcal vaccine Prevnar 13 and cardiology drugs Vyndaqel and Eliquis. Pfizer sells these products globally, with international sales representing 40% of total sales. Within international sales, emerging markets are a major contributor.
